Construction Debris Removal in Chico, CA
Construction debris removal services help homeowners clear away waste generated by renovation, remodeling, or new construction projects. This service typically covers materials such as drywall, wood, concrete, roofing shingles, fixtures, and other leftover debris that accumulates during building or demolition work. Property owners often seek this service to maintain a clean, safe environment during and after construction, ensuring that debris does not obstruct work areas or pose hazards on the property.
Before requesting construction debris removal, homeowners should consider the scope of their project and the types of materials involved. It's helpful to understand whether the debris is mixed or separated, as some materials may require special disposal methods. Clarifying the amount of waste and the timeline for removal can also assist in planning the cleanup process efficiently. This service is valuable for keeping properties tidy and compliant with local disposal regulations after construction or renovation activities.

Common Construction Debris Removal Jobs
Construction debris removal involves clearing away leftover materials from renovation or building projects.
Roofing debris removal includes disposing of shingles, wood, and other materials after roof replacement.
Demolition debris removal handles the cleanup of broken concrete, drywall, and framing after demolition work.
Garage or basement renovation debris removal helps clear out old fixtures, drywall, and flooring waste.
Landscaping debris removal includes hauling away soil, rocks, and discarded landscaping materials.
Remodeling debris removal manages the disposal of packaging, scrap, and construction waste from interior upgrades.
Construction Debris Removal Questions
What types of construction debris are typically removed? Common debris includes wood, drywall, concrete, bricks, and roofing materials from renovation or demolition projects.
Is construction debris removal necessary after a home renovation? Yes, removing debris helps maintain a clean work site and ensures proper disposal of construction waste.
What should property owners do before debris removal? Clear the area of personal belongings and ensure access to debris piles for efficient removal.
How is construction debris disposed of? Debris is sorted and transported to appropriate disposal or recycling facilities according to local regulations.
